Transaction 58f2afcd220cca0cdc3191c27f7a7e0161c2925f0edf2cfe66dafcd9f4f64dd3
1 Input
2 Outputs
- 58f2afcd220cca0cdc3191c27f7a7e0161c2925f0edf2cfe66dafcd9f4f64dd3:0
- 58f2afcd220cca0cdc3191c27f7a7e0161c2925f0edf2cfe66dafcd9f4f64dd3:1
value 2840552676
address 1JFcvumdakpcLcaE3ejjzPbXsdUcWnn8fW
value 3549843
address 19yMKxdmJf4KtLEZUo28f4ZJwRRkaQAraP